2011-03-22 152 views
0

我已經爲android做了小應用程序,當我在高分辨率模擬器(如HVGA)中執行應用程序時,它看起來很好,我在我的android手機中嘗試了同樣的事情,其中​​我看到了像素小部件在邊緣打破,然後我使用QVGA同樣的事情在我的模擬器發生得創建一個模擬器,它看起來像低分辨率設備兼容性

enter image description here

我無法找到一個解決方案,任何幫助,我m使用Android 2.2 API 8,移動版本是2.2.1

謝謝。

回答

3
  • 定義中密度獨立像素的各種尺寸(dip S),使您的尺寸與分辨率的正確尺度的變化
  • 建立不同版本的圖片,這樣的Android不必縮放它們本身,並放置在drawable-ldpi(QVGA),drawable-mdpi(HVGA)和drawable-hdpi(WVGA +)文件夾。
  • 看看Supporting Multiple Screens
  • 定義不同的佈局更小的設備,必要時
+0

感謝您的快速回復。是的,我只給了'dp'一切。 – Vignesh 2011-03-22 11:28:50

0

我只是用「DP」值每一個屬性,我已經給了一個線

支持屏anyDensity =「true」

在AndroidManifest.xml中,現在看起來不錯。 感謝Joseph Earl的鏈接。